SUMMARY:Atlantic Trade Mission – Hannover Messe 2025 – March 30 – April 4\, 2025
DESCRIPTION:About The Trade Mission: \nInnovation PEI is excited to join the proponent Invest Nova Scotia\, the other Atlantic Provinces and Atlantic Opportunities Agency (ACOA) to lead an Atlantic trade mission to Hannover Messe 2025. \nRegistration is now open for Atlantic Canadian companies and innovation ecosystem partners to participate in the world’s leading industrial trade fair\, Hannover Messe\, in Germany from March 30 to April 4\, 2025. \n  \nAbout Hannover Messe: \nHannover Messe is the largest industrial trade fair\, showcasing cutting-edge innovations in digital technologies\, clean technologies\, and resilient supply chains. In 2023\, it attracted 130\,000 visitors\, 4\,000 exhibitors\, 1\,600 speakers\, and 300 startups. The 2025 theme is “Shaping the future with technology”—and Canada will be the partner country. \nAs part of the Atlantic Canada Pavilion in Hall 2\, your company will gain visibility and opportunities to engage with global industry leaders. \n  \nWho Should Attend?  \nWe are seeking up to 12 export-ready companies from Atlantic Canada\, including those led by underrepresented groups. DESCRIPTION:Expo ANTAD and Alimentaria is Mexico’s largest retail-focused trade show. The Trade Commissioner Service (TCS) in Mexico has coordinated a Canada Pavilion at this event for over a decade with participation from key Canada agri-food trade associations as well as Canadian provinces. The Expo is divided into two halls – the national hall where major retail organizations have their stands and the international hall where we can find many country pavilions. At the March 2024 edition of ANTAD\, the expo counted more than 1\,200 exhibitors and the event was attended by close to 47\,000 visitors from 67 countries. \nOne of the unique features of this trade show is that Mexico’s major retailers\, convenience stores\, specialty stores\, and department store chains\, as well as a range of distributors have booths at the event with buyers onsite. Several retailers of interest to Canadian exporters including Soriana\, Chedraui\, Walmart\, La Comer\, H-E-B\, Casa Ley\, and Liverpool have their teams of buyers at the show. This allows the Canadian delegation to meet with key decision makers and provides great visibility for companies who are already present in the Mexican market and for new-to-market exporters. \nAt the last edition of ANTAD in March 2024\, the Canada Pavilion showcased 21 Canadian exhibitors.  Companies took part in a pre-event briefing and visits as well as a program of pre-arranged B2B meetings\, held in-person at the expo.  The B2B program resulted in 258 coordinated meetings with Mexican retailers\, importers and/or distributors for the 21 Canadian companies\, an average of 12 meetings per company with their key targets. Exhibitors reported that their participation in Expo ANTAD & Alimentaria resulted in over 115 sales leads and potential projected sales of up to CAD$10.2 million. \nThis year\, the Trade Commissioner Service will again be offering pre-show webinars as well as on-site activities including a briefing\, market and retail tours and a group dinner.
